31 #include <sys/types.h>
32 #include <sys/socket.h> /* for PF_LINK */
33 #include <sys/sysctl.h>
34 #include <sys/time.h>
35
36 #include <err.h>
37 #include <errno.h>
38 #include <stdio.h>
39 #include <stdlib.h>
40 #include <string.h>
41 #include <sysexits.h>
42 #include <unistd.h>
43
44 #include <net/if.h>
45 #include <net/if_types.h>
46 #include <net/if_mib.h>
47
48 #include "ifinfo.h"
49
50 static void printit(const struct ifmibdata *, const char *);
51 static const char *iftype(int);
52 static int isit(int, char **, const char *);
53 static printfcn findlink(int);
54
55 static void
usage(const char * argv0)56 usage(const char *argv0)
57 {
58 fprintf(stderr, "%s: usage:\n\t%s [-l]\n", argv0, argv0);
59 exit(EX_USAGE);
60 }
61
62 int
main(int argc,char ** argv)63 main(int argc, char **argv)
64 {
65 int i, maxifno, retval;
66 struct ifmibdata ifmd;
67 int name[6];
68 size_t len;
69 int c;
70 int dolink = 0;
71 void *linkmib;
72 size_t linkmiblen;
73 printfcn pf;
74 char *dname;
75
76 while ((c = getopt(argc, argv, "l")) != -1) {
77 switch(c) {
78 case 'l':
79 dolink = 1;
80 break;
81 default:
82 usage(argv[0]);
83 }
84 }
85
86 retval = 1;
87
88 name[0] = CTL_NET;
89 name[1] = PF_LINK;
90 name[2] = NETLINK_GENERIC;
91 name[3] = IFMIB_SYSTEM;
92 name[4] = IFMIB_IFCOUNT;
93
94 len = sizeof maxifno;
95 if (sysctl(name, 5, &maxifno, &len, 0, 0) < 0)
96 err(EX_OSERR, "sysctl(net.link.generic.system.ifcount)");
97
98 for (i = 1; i <= maxifno; i++) {
99 len = sizeof ifmd;
100 name[3] = IFMIB_IFDATA;
101 name[4] = i;
102 name[5] = IFDATA_GENERAL;
103 if (sysctl(name, 6, &ifmd, &len, 0, 0) < 0) {
104 if (errno == ENOENT)
105 continue;
106
107 err(EX_OSERR, "sysctl(net.link.ifdata.%d.general)",
108 i);
109 }
110
111 if (!isit(argc - optind, argv + optind, ifmd.ifmd_name))
112 continue;
113
114 dname = NULL;
115 len = 0;
116 name[5] = IFDATA_DRIVERNAME;
117 if (sysctl(name, 6, NULL, &len, 0, 0) < 0) {
118 warn("sysctl(net.link.ifdata.%d.drivername)", i);
119 } else {
120 if ((dname = malloc(len)) == NULL)
121 err(EX_OSERR, NULL);
122 if (sysctl(name, 6, dname, &len, 0, 0) < 0) {
123 warn("sysctl(net.link.ifdata.%d.drivername)",
124 i);
125 free(dname);
126 dname = NULL;
127 }
128 }
129 printit(&ifmd, dname);
130 free(dname);
131 if (dolink && (pf = findlink(ifmd.ifmd_data.ifi_type))) {
132 name[5] = IFDATA_LINKSPECIFIC;
133 if (sysctl(name, 6, 0, &linkmiblen, 0, 0) < 0)
134 err(EX_OSERR,
135 "sysctl(net.link.ifdata.%d.linkspec) size",
136 i);
137 linkmib = malloc(linkmiblen);
138 if (!linkmib)
139 err(EX_OSERR, "malloc(%lu)",
140 (u_long)linkmiblen);
141 if (sysctl(name, 6, linkmib, &linkmiblen, 0, 0) < 0)
142 err(EX_OSERR,
143 "sysctl(net.link.ifdata.%d.linkspec)",
144 i);
145 pf(linkmib, linkmiblen);
146 free(linkmib);
147 }
148 retval = 0;
149 }
150
151 return retval;
152 }
